West Side Story is a romantic musical movie, written by Ernest Lehman and directed Jerome Robbins in 1961. The movie starring Natalie Wood and Richard Beymer, who play Maria and Tony, the americans Romeo and Juliette.

The story take place in Manhattan. Two street gangs of youngs boys, the Sharks and the Jets, fight. The Sharks are Puerto Rican immigrants, and the Jets are americans. At the dancing, Tony, the second leader of the Jets, meets Maria, the Sharks leader' little sister. They immediately fall in love. When the two lovers decided to run away together, a fight break out. Bernado (Sharks leader) kills Riff (Jets leader) and Tony kills Bernado. To avenge the Bernado's death, a Puerto rican kills in his turn Tony. Maria is break down. Finally, the three deaths are so shocking for everyone, so the Sharks and the Jets are reconciled.

This movie are very emotional, particularly the dance scene. All the actors are excellents dancers and singers, and very synchronized. The songs are so lively, swinging beat. The love story is very cute at the beginning, and take a dramatic side at the end. It's the same impossible love to Romeo and Juliette. Nobody can't have a tear in seeing the end.

In my mind, West Side Story is a film to see at least one time in a life, a classic.
